How Does Size and Space Influence Dishwasher Selection?

When selecting a dishwasher, size and space are crucial considerations that can significantly impact both functionality and performance. Here are the main factors to keep in mind regarding size and space:

  • Standard Dimensions: Most dishwashers have standard sizes, typically around 24 inches wide, 24 inches deep, and 35 inches high. Ensure your kitchen has appropriate space to accommodate these measurements, accounting for any cabinetry.

  • Height Limitations: Verify the height of your undercounter space. Dishwashers can vary in height, and some models may require an additional inch or two for installation.

  • Compact Options: If your kitchen is small, consider compact dishwashers, which are around 18 inches wide. They are ideal for apartments or kitchens with limited space while still offering adequate cleaning power.

  • Built-in vs. Portable: A built-in dishwasher requires plumbing and designated space, while portable models can be rolled into the kitchen when needed. Choose based on your long-term needs and flexibility.

  • Door Clearance: Ensure there’s enough clearance for the door to open fully without obstruction, especially if it swings out rather than sliding in.

  • Layout Considerations: Assess your kitchen layout. Proximity to the sink and ease of access can influence the efficiency of loading and unloading dishes.

Taking these factors into account will help ensure the selected dishwasher integrates smoothly into your kitchen space.

What Energy Efficiency Ratings Should You Look For?

When looking for energy-efficient dishwashers, consider the following key ratings:

  • Energy Star Certification: This label indicates that the dishwasher meets strict energy efficiency guidelines set by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ency. Dishwashers with this certification typically use 10% less energy and 20% less water than non-certified models, making them a cost-effective choice in the long run.
  • Water Efficiency Rating (WER): This rating helps consumers understand how much water a dishwasher uses per cycle. A lower WER indicates better efficiency, and models with a WER of 3.5 gallons or less are generally considered to be very efficient, saving both water and energy.
  • Modified Energy Factor (MEF): MEF measures the energy efficiency of dishwashers, taking into account the energy consumed for washing, drying, and standby modes. A higher MEF value means that the dishwasher uses less energy, which is crucial for reducing utility bills over time.
  • Annual Energy Use (kWh/year): This figure represents the total energy consumption of the dishwasher in a year. Dishwashers that use less than 300 kWh per year are considered energy-efficient, helping to minimize environmental impact while saving money on electricity.

How Do Cleaning Technologies Vary Among Dishwashers?

Cleaning technologies in dishwashers can vary significantly, impacting their efficiency and effectiveness.

  • Soil Sensors: Dishwashers equipped with soil sensors can detect the level of dirtiness on the dishes and adjust the wash cycle accordingly. This technology optimizes water and energy usage by only running a more intensive cleaning process when necessary, ensuring both cleanliness and efficiency.
  • Multi-Level Wash Systems: These systems utilize multiple spray arms and varied water pressure to reach all areas of the dishwasher. This ensures that every dish, regardless of its position, receives an adequate wash, minimizing the need for pre-rinsing and enhancing cleaning performance.
  • Steam Cleaning: Some dishwashers feature steam cleaning technology, which uses steam to loosen tough, baked-on food residues. This method can reduce the need for harsh detergents and can be particularly effective for sanitizing and deep cleaning without using excessive water.
  • Smart Cleaning Features: Smart dishwashers often integrate with home automation systems, allowing users to monitor and control the cleaning cycle remotely. These features can provide notifications for maintenance and efficiency, ensuring the dishwasher is running optimally and effectively.
  • Quiet Operation Technology: Many modern dishwashers employ sound-dampening technologies that reduce operational noise. While this does not directly impact cleaning efficiency, it enhances user experience, allowing for uninterrupted activities in the home while the dishwasher is running.

How Important Is Drying Performance in a Dishwasher?

Drying performance is a critical factor to consider when evaluating dishwashers, as it directly impacts the cleanliness and usability of your dishes after a wash cycle.

  • Heat Drying: This method uses a heating element to raise the temperature inside the dishwasher, effectively evaporating moisture from the dishes. While it is generally effective, it can increase energy consumption and may not be suitable for energy-efficient models.
  • Fan Drying: Utilizes a fan to circulate air within the dishwasher, promoting faster evaporation of water from dishes. This method tends to be quieter and more energy-efficient than heat drying, but it may not always produce completely dry dishes, particularly in humid conditions.
  • Condensation Drying: This technique relies on the natural temperature difference between the hot dishes and the cooler interior of the dishwasher to encourage moisture to condense on the walls and drain away. While it is energy-efficient and often found in high-end models, it may leave some items damp, especially plastics.
  • Rinse Aid Usage: Rinse aids help to reduce water spots and improve drying performance by breaking the surface tension of water. By using rinse aid, you can enhance the drying results regardless of the drying method employed in the dishwasher.
  • Loading Efficiency: How dishes are loaded can significantly affect drying performance, as proper spacing allows for better air circulation and evaporation. Ensuring that items are not overcrowded and that larger items do not block smaller ones can help achieve optimal drying results.

How Can You Maintain Dishwasher Cleanliness?

Maintaining dishwasher cleanliness is crucial for optimal performance and longevity.

  • Regularly Clean the Filter: The filter traps food particles and debris that can clog the dishwasher and lead to odors. It should be removed and rinsed under running water at least once a month to prevent buildup.
  • Run a Vinegar Cycle: Using white vinegar can help remove limescale and mineral deposits from the interior of the dishwasher. Pour a cup of vinegar into a dishwasher-safe container and place it on the top rack before running a hot water cycle.
  • Inspect and Clean Spray Arms: Clogged spray arms can hinder water flow and cleaning efficiency. Remove the spray arms if possible and check for blockages, using a toothpick or small brush to clear out any debris in the nozzle holes.
  • Wipe Down Seals and Gaskets: The rubber seals around the door can accumulate grime and mold, which can affect performance and cause odors. Wipe them down with a damp cloth and mild detergent regularly to keep them clean and functional.
  • Use Dishwasher Cleaner: Commercial dishwasher cleaners are specifically designed to break down grease and limescale buildup. Regular use can help maintain freshness and cleanliness, preventing odor and enhancing performance.
